Analysis

In 2019, mean hemoglobin level of pregnant women in Sur stood at 119. That is the highest value across all 20 years on record.

That represents a change of unchanged over ten years.

Over the whole period, mean hemoglobin level of pregnant women in Sur peaked at 119 in 2009 and was at its lowest, 117, in 2000.
